Above, an angler shows his biggest trout ever. The fish was landed during the Redbone Tournament for Cystic Fibrosis. This one missed winning the Largest Trout in the Tournament by only one inch. VERY NICE TROUT!

Above, Professional Redfish Guide Capt. Richie Lott displays a Fall Redfish from a river in the "Backcountry" areas of Sea Island. These fish become a regular catch during certain tide levels around oyster shell beds in our area.

Excellent Trout and Redfishing can be found in the mouth of Sounds during certain times of the year and tide levels. If "keeper" fish are on your agenda, this trip will normally fit the bill.

Catching Flounder is always a possiblity while inshore fishing our Backwater areas! This Flounder fell victim to a live mullet in 2 ft. of water near a shell rake.
